Java Python Full Stack Developer

1 week ago


Knutsford Cheshire, United Kingdom Ubique Systems Full time

Key Responsibilities:

  •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.
  • End-to-End Change Automation: Lead the automation of the end-to-end change management process, focusing on guardrail governance, lifecycle management, and DevOps integration.
  • Backend Development: Leverage extensive experience in backend development, with strong programming skills in Java and Python, to build and optimize scalable software systems.
  • Full-Stack Development: Apply full-stack development experience to ensure seamless integration across the technology stack, focusing on both backend and frontend systems where necessary.
  • Data Augmentation & Kafka: Implement and manage real-time data augmentation processes, utilizing Kafka for efficient data streaming and processing.
  • Architecture & Metadata Management: Design and maintain architecture that supports automated backup processes and metadata acquisition, ensuring smooth and frictionless operations.
  • CAF Process Optimization: Lead efforts to automate and streamline the CAF process, reducing delivery time and improving governance standards.
  • Strategic Change & Transformation: Contribute to strategic change initiatives, driving digital transformation and aligning development efforts with the bank’s long-term goals.
  • Leadership & Collaboration: Provide technical leadership and guidance to the development team, fostering collaboration and continuous learning.
  • Test Automation & Secure Coding: Implement test automation practices and ensure secure coding standards are adhered to, maintaining high-quality and secure software development.

Mandatory Skills:

  • Technical Troubleshooting: Strong troubleshooting skills to quickly identify and resolve technical issues.
  • Continuous Learning: Commitment to continuous learning and staying updated with the latest technology trends and best practices.
  • Software Design & Strategic Thinking: Expertise in software design, with the ability to think strategically about long-term technology solutions.
  • Change & Transformation: Experience in leading change and transformation initiatives within a complex organization.
  • Digital & Technology Proficiency: Deep understanding of digital technologies and their application in financial services.
  • Computer Programming: Proficient in Java and Python, with a focus on backend development.
  • Business Acumen: Strong understanding of business processes and how they can be enhanced through technology.
  • Secure Coding Practices: Adherence to secure coding practices to protect sensitive information and ensure compliance with regulatory standards.
  • Teamwork & Communication: Excellent teamwork and communication skills, with the ability to work effectively with cross-functional teams.
  • Test Automation & Problem Solving: Proficiency in test automation and problem-solving tools to ensure the delivery of high-quality software.
  • Risk & Controls: Understanding of risk management and control processes, particularly in the context of software development and deployment.

This role is ideal for a Senior Developer / Lead Developer with a strong background in backend development, full-stack experience, and a deep understanding of data processing and architecture. The successful candidate will lead the bank's efforts to automate and optimize its change management processes, driving innovation and efficiency in a regulatory-driven environment.



  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ities: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ities: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ities: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ities: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als. End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ities:The following information aims to provide potential candidates with a better understanding of the requirements for this role.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ize...


  • Knutsford, United Kingdom Ubique Systems Full time

    Key Responsibilities: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, Cheshire, United Kingdom Ubique Systems Full time

    Key Responsibilities: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als. End-to-End Change Automation: Lead the automation of the...


  • Knutsford, Cheshire, United Kingdom Ubique Systems Full time

    Key Responsibilities: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als. End-to-End Change Automation: Lead the automation of the...


  • Knutsford, UK, Cheshire, United Kingdom Ubique Systems Full time

    Key Responsibilities:Software Design &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ology capabilities for the bank's customers and colleagues. Utilize advanced engineering methodologies to achieve these goals.End-to-End Change Automation: Lead the automation of the end-to-end...


  • Knutsford, Cheshire East, United Kingdom Ubique Systems Full time

    Job SummaryUbique Systems is seeking a highly skilled Senior Backend Developer to lead our efforts in automating and optimizing change management processes. As a key member of our development team, you will be responsible for designing, developing, and implementing scalable software systems using Java and Python.Key ResponsibilitiesSoftware Design and...


  • Knutsford, Cheshire East, United Kingdom Ubique Systems Full time

    About the RoleWe are seeking a highly skilled Senior Backend Developer to lead our efforts in automating and optimizing change management processes. As a key member of our development team, you will be responsible for designing, developing, and continuously improving software solutions that provide robust business platforms and technology capabilities for...


  • Knutsford, Cheshire East, United Kingdom Ubique Systems Full time

    About the RoleThis is a senior-level position that requires a strong background in backend development, full-stack experience, and a deep understanding of data processing and architecture.Key ResponsibilitiesSoftware Design and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ology...


  • Knutsford, Cheshire East, United Kingdom Ubique Systems Full time

    About the RoleThis is a senior-level position that requires a strong background in backend development, full-stack experience, and a deep understanding of data processing and architecture.Key ResponsibilitiesSoftware Design and Development: Design, develop, and continuously improve software solutions that provide robust business platforms and technology...


  • Knutsford, Cheshire East, United Kingdom Ubique Systems Full time

    About the RoleUbique Systems is seeking a highly skilled Senior Backend Developer to lead our efforts in automating and optimizing change management processes. As a key member of our development team, you will be responsible for designing, developing, and continuously improving software solutions that provide robust business platforms and technology...

  • Java Developer

    3 weeks ago


    Chester, Cheshire, United Kingdom Collabera Digital Full time

    Job Description: As a Senior Java Developer, you will leverage your 10+ years of experience to design, develop, and maintain complex banking applications. Your expertise in Java, Spring, Angular, and Microservices will play a pivotal role in shaping our technology stack and delivering high-quality solutions. You will collaborate with cross-functional teams...

  • Java Developer

    2 weeks ago


    Chester, Cheshire, United Kingdom Collabera Digital Full time

    Job Description: As a Senior Java Developer, you will leverage your 10+ years of experience to design, develop, and maintain complex banking applications. Your expertise in Java, Spring, Angular, and Microservices will play a pivotal role in shaping our technology stack and delivering high-quality solutions. You will collaborate with cross-functional teams...


  • Chester, Cheshire, United Kingdom Oscar Associates (UK) Limited Full time €45,000

    Full Stack Developer - Laravel, Vue, Tailwind Digital Agency - Chester, Hybrid Up to £45,000 plus benefits This is an opportunity for a Full Stack Developer to join a leading digital agency based in Chester, operating on a predominantly remote basis. You will join an existing high-functioning development and product team who are building bespoke...

  • Full Stack Engineer

    3 weeks ago


    Cheshire East, Cheshire, United Kingdom Candour Solutions Full time

    Senior Full Stack Developer Cheshire - Hybrid (2-3 days a week in office) Candour have partnered with a leading software company going through a phase of growth as a result of huge success in the last few years. They provide a combination of services, including a suite of SaaS solutions, as well as consultancy services for the digital risk and compliance...

  • Full Stack Engineer

    2 weeks ago


    Cheshire East, Cheshire, United Kingdom Candour Solutions Full time

    Senior Full Stack Developer Cheshire - Hybrid (2-3 days a week in office) Candour have partnered with a leading software company going through a phase of growth as a result of huge success in the last few years. They provide a combination of services, including a suite of SaaS solutions, as well as consultancy services for the digital risk and compliance...


  • Chester, Cheshire, United Kingdom Collabera Digital Full time

    Job Overview: We are seeking a talented and motivated Java Developer with Python expertise to join our software development team. The ideal candidate will have strong experience in Java development, complemented by the ability to utilize Python for scripting, automation, and data processing tasks. This role involves working on complex projects,...